Transaction 036552f79e77eeae4c4c22d2605539e35b5ba633bb4bdf504b97a24f264f43a9

2 Input
2 Outputs
  • 036552f79e77eeae4c4c22d2605539e35b5ba633bb4bdf504b97a24f264f43a9:0
  • value  98456
    address  35VFxfWYBBehdH4x3zyBPst1AQH6au4Bto
  • 036552f79e77eeae4c4c22d2605539e35b5ba633bb4bdf504b97a24f264f43a9:1
  • value  687910
    address  32fBa7b6TFhqEfnVJB5gd4Ne5eWGpV7xbk